Comparing Retail vs Bulk Pricing Tiers

In the chemical supply market, a distinct dichotomy exists between laboratory-scale retail packaging and industrial bulk procurement. Retail suppliers often distribute materials like Pentafluoropentanoic acid in amber glass bottles ranging from 1g to 100g. While convenient for initial screening, these units carry a significant premium per kilogram. Furthermore, retail specifications frequently list percent purity around 90%, which is often insufficient for large-scale reaction pathways where byproduct accumulation can compromise yield.

Industrial buyers must prioritize assay values above 98% to ensure consistent reaction kinetics. When evaluating suppliers for industrial purity, buyers should scrutinize the Certificate of Analysis (COA) for impurities such as residual solvents or incomplete fluorination byproducts. The cost difference between 90% and 99% purity is not merely linear; it reflects the additional distillation and purification cycles required during the manufacturing process. Volume Discount Structures for Industrial Orders

Securing favorable terms for fluorinated building blocks requires an understanding of volume discount structures. Manufacturers typically tier pricing based on annual commitment and single-order quantity. For CAS 3637-31-8, orders exceeding 500kg often trigger significant price reductions compared to spot purchases of 25kg drums. This is due to the efficiency gains in the synthesis route. Running larger batches reduces the relative cost of catalyst loading, solvent recovery, and quality control testing per unit.

Logistics also play a pivotal role in the final landed cost. Fluorinated compounds often require specific hazard classifications for transport, adhering to GHS Signal Word: Danger protocols. Bulk shipments consolidate these logistical overheads. A reliable global manufacturer will optimize packaging to maximize container load while ensuring safety compliance. Procurement teams should negotiate Incoterms that reflect these efficiencies, such as FOB or CIF, depending on their internal logistics capabilities. Consistency in supply is as valuable as price stability; interrupted supply chains can halt production lines, costing far more than marginal savings on material costs.
